
A young mother inexplicably disappears in the middle of the night only to be found savagely murdered the next morning, prompting police to retrace the tumultuous events of her last night on Earth.




Other episodes for this season
















A young mother inexplicably disappears in the middle of the night only to be found savagely murdered the next morning, prompting police to retrace the tumultuous events of her last night on Earth.